The Role of the Master Antioxidant

To understand the dosage, we first need to understand what glutathione does in the body. It is a tripeptide made of three amino acids: cysteine, glycine, and glutamic acid. While every cell in your body produces it, your levels can be depleted by stress, environmental factors, and the natural process of ageing.

Glutathione influences the appearance of your skin by interacting with melanin. Melanin is the pigment that gives our skin, hair, and eyes their color. There are two main types of melanin in our bodies: eumelanin and pheomelanin. Eumelanin is responsible for darker pigments, while pheomelanin creates lighter, more reddish-yellow tones.

Glutathione works by inhibiting an enzyme called tyrosinase. This enzyme is the primary trigger for melanin production. When glutathione levels are high, the body may shift away from producing darker eumelanin and toward producing lighter pheomelanin. This internal shift is what leads to a brighter, more even skin tone over time.

Key Takeaway: Skin brightening occurs when glutathione shifts the body's pigment production from dark melanin (eumelanin) to lighter melanin (pheomelanin) by regulating the tyrosinase enzyme.

How Many Grams of Glutathione to Whiten Skin

When searching for the right amount to take, you will find that "standard" doses for general health are often lower than those suggested for skin brightening. For general antioxidant support, many people find that 500 to 1,000 milligrams (0.5 to 1 gram) per day is sufficient. However, the skin-brightening effect is often considered a "secondary" benefit that occurs when the body has an abundance of glutathione.

Calculations are typically based on body weight. The most common formula used in wellness circles is 20 to 40 milligrams of glutathione per kilogram of body weight. Because US audiences typically use pounds, we have to convert your weight to kilograms first.

Converting Weight to Dosing

To find your weight in kilograms, divide your weight in pounds by 2.2. Once you have that number, multiply it by the range of 20mg to 40mg.

  • Example 1: A person weighing 130 lbs
    • 130 / 2.2 = approximately 59 kg.
    • Lower end (20mg): 1,180mg (1.18 grams) per day.
    • Higher end (40mg): 2,360mg (2.36 grams) per day.
  • Example 2: A person weighing 170 lbs
    • 170 / 2.2 = approximately 77 kg.
    • Lower end (20mg): 1,540mg (1.54 grams) per day.
    • Higher end (40mg): 3,080mg (3.08 grams) per day.
  • Example 3: A person weighing 210 lbs
    • 210 / 2.2 = approximately 95 kg.
    • Lower end (20mg): 1,900mg (1.9 grams) per day.
    • Higher end (40mg): 3,800mg (3.8 grams) per day.

Individual requirements always vary. These numbers are general guidelines. Factors like your metabolic rate, your current glutathione levels, and even how much sun exposure you get can change how your body responds to these dosages. It is always wise to consult with a healthcare professional before starting a high-dose routine.

Why Bioavailability Changes Everything

If you simply buy a standard glutathione capsule and take three grams a day, you might be disappointed. This is because standard glutathione has a major weakness: your digestive system.

Most standard glutathione supplements are destroyed by stomach acid. Glutathione is a fragile molecule. When it hits the harsh environment of the stomach, it often breaks down into its component amino acids before it can ever reach your bloodstream. This means that if you take 1,000mg in a standard pill, your body might only absorb a tiny fraction of that amount.

Bioavailability is the measure of how much of a nutrient actually enters your circulation. It is the most important factor in any supplement routine. If the bioavailability is low, the dose on the label is essentially meaningless. This is why many people who take high doses of standard glutathione see no change in their skin. The Liposomal Difference

To solve the absorption problem, we use liposomal delivery. A liposome is a tiny, fatty bubble (a lipid vesicle) that mimics the structure of your own cell membranes. This "bubble" encapsulates the glutathione, protecting it as it travels through the digestive tract.

Liposomal delivery allows the nutrient to bypass the typical digestion process. Because the liposome is made of phospholipids—the same material as your cell walls—it can merge with the cells in your gut lining and deliver the glutathione directly into the bloodstream.

Factors That Influence Your Results

Taking glutathione is not a "magic fix" that works overnight. Because it works by changing the way your body produces new pigment, the process is gradual. Several lifestyle factors can speed up or slow down your progress.

1. Baseline Skin Tone

Your starting point determines how long it will take to see a visible change. Those with lighter complexions may notice a shift in 1 to 3 months. Those with deeper skin tones may need 6 to 12 months of consistent supplementation. This is because the turnover of skin cells takes time, and the "old" pigment must naturally flake away to reveal the "new" tone beneath.

2. Vitamin C Levels

Glutathione and Vitamin C have a powerful relationship. Vitamin C helps keep glutathione in its "reduced" state, which is the active form that provides antioxidant benefits. Many people find that taking Vitamin C alongside their glutathione supports better results. Our Liposomal Vitamin C is a great addition to this routine, as it also uses the same advanced delivery technology to ensure absorption.

3. Sun Exposure

This is perhaps the most important external factor. UV rays trigger the production of melanin. If you are taking glutathione to brighten your skin but spending hours in the sun without protection, you are essentially pulling your body in two different directions. Protecting your skin from the sun helps maintain the progress you make with your supplements.

4. Lifestyle Choices

Glutathione is the body's primary detoxifier. If you drink alcohol frequently or smoke, your body will use up its glutathione stores to process those toxins. This leaves less glutathione available for cosmetic benefits like skin brightening. Reducing toxin exposure can help "free up" glutathione for your skin. What to Expect on Your Journey

It is important to have realistic expectations. Glutathione is a supplement, not a medical treatment. It supports your body's natural processes. You should not expect an instant change. Most people report a "glow" or an "evenness" in their skin before they notice a change in the actual shade.

The first few weeks: You might not see any change in your skin tone, but you may feel more energetic. This is because glutathione is working on cellular detoxification and liver health first.

One to three months: This is the window where many people start to see a "lit-from-within" radiance. Dark spots may begin to look softer, and the overall complexion may appear more uniform.

Six months and beyond: For those looking for more significant brightening, this is the timeframe where deep-seated pigment changes typically become visible. At this stage, many people move to a "maintenance" dose, which is often lower than their initial brightening dose.

Note: If you are pregnant, nursing, or taking medication for a diagnosed condition, always talk to your healthcare provider before adding high-dose glutathione to your routine.
